The Reactions of 1, 2-Cyclopentanedione Dioxime and of 1, 2, 3-and 1,3,5-Cyclohexanetrione Trioximes in Liquid Sulfur Dioxide

2-Cyclopentanedione dioxime (II), 1, 2, 3-cyclohexanetrione trioxime (III) and 1, 3, 5-cyclohexanetrione trioxime (IV) were treated with reagents and exhibited different and characteristic behaviors in liquid sulfur dioxide.
